The global HVAC insulation market size was estimated at USD 7.4 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 10.5 bill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 4.6% from 2026 to 2033. The market is primarily driven by the increasing demand for energy-efficient buildings across residential, commercial, and industrial sectors.
Rising electricity costs and stringent government regulations related to energy conservation are encouraging the adoption of insulated HVAC systems that minimize heat loss and improve operational efficiency. Rapid urbanization, growing construction activities, and expanding commercial infrastructure such as offices, hospitals, airports, shopping malls, and data centers are further supporting market growth. Another major growth driver is the rising focus on indoor comfort, fire safety, and sustainable building solutions. HVAC insulation helps reduce noise levels, control condensation, and improve indoor air quality, making it an essential component in modern buildings. Growing awareness regarding green buildings and LEED-certified infrastructure is also accelerating the use of advanced insulation materials such as elastomeric foam, mineral wool, and PIR/PUR foam. Furthermore, technological advancements in lightweight and high-performance insulation products, along with increasing retrofit activities in older buildings, are expected to continue driving the market.
